Download presentation
Presentation is loading. Please wait.
1
1 InfiniBand HW Architecture InfiniBand Unified Fabric InfiniBand Architecture Router xCA Link Topology Switched Fabric (vs shared bus) 64K nodes per sub-net Multiple subnets bridged w/routers IPv6 addressing x-subnet Fabric Transactions Unified fabric for IPC, Networking, and Storage Channel based interconnect Closely integrated with Mem Ctrlr QoS (Service Levels, Virtual Lanes) Reliability Automatic fail-over in switch Support for redundant fabrics Physical Layer Cost Effective Four wire link (2 pairs) Enables volume deployments 2.5Gb/sec signaling rate Copper & Fiber support Multiple link widths 1x -2.5 Gbits/sec 4x - 10 Gb/sec 12x - 30 Gb/sec Hosts InfiniBand Switch Network Router Storage 1 2 3 n.. CPU Mem Cntlr HCA CPU Mem Cntlr HCA CPU Mem Cntlr HCA Link CPU Mem Cntlr HCA Switch Link TCA N/W Target TCA Storage Target Link 1 2 3 n
2
2
3
3
4
4 Virtual Lane (VL) z Multiplex multiple independent data streams onto a single physical link which provides: y Differentiated services on a packet-boundary basis y Increase fabric utilization in the face of head-of-line blocking on a given VL and via VL-based routing across multiple paths y Support for up to 16 VLs with 1 VL reserved for fabric management y Implementations shall support a minimum of 1 VL application usage and 1 VL for fabric management De- Mux Mux Packets
5
5 Messages & Packets z Applications, drivers, devices, adapters, etc. execute transactions via logical units of work termed messages. z H/W-based memory / resource protection to prevent unauthorized access to messages z Message semantics supported are: y Memory - RDMA Read / Write y Channel - Send / Receive y Atomics (optional functionality) y Multicast (optional functionality) z InfiniBand technology H/W provides automatic message segmentation and re-assembly via packets y End-to-end fabric unit of transfer Transaction Message Packet Message
6
6
7
7
Similar presentations
© 2024 SlidePlayer.com. Inc.
All rights reserved.